What is a strategic communications associate?

A Strategic Communications Associate is a professional who helps develop and implement communication strategies to support an organization’s goals. They work on crafting clear messaging, managing media relations, and coordinating internal and external communications. Their responsibilities often include drafting press releases, preparing presentations, and monitoring media coverage. This role is vital for ensuring that information about the organization is effectively conveyed to stakeholders, the public, and the media.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a strategic communications associate?

To thrive as a Strategic Communications Associate, you need excellent written and verbal communication abilities, a bachelor's degree in communications or a related field, and strong analytical skills. Familiarity with media monitoring platforms, content management systems, and social media analytics tools is typically required. Creativity, adaptability, and relationship-building are standout soft skills for effectively managing messaging and stakeholder engagement. These competencies enable effective communication strategies, brand consistency, and positive public perception for organizations.

How does a strategic communications associate typically collaborate with other departments within an organization?

A Strategic Communications Associate frequently works cross-functionally, partnering with teams such as marketing, public relations, and senior leadership to ensure consistent messaging and alignment with organizational goals. This role often involves attending interdepartmental meetings, gathering input on key initiatives, and translating complex information into clear, engaging communications for both internal and external audiences. Strong collaboration skills are essential, as the associate may coordinate campaigns, respond to media inquiries, and support crisis communication efforts alongside various stakeholders.

The Corporate Communications department at Publix spearheads internal communications and press releases, publishes monthly newsletters and annual benefits notices, handles department-specific communications, and manages digital content for Publix's internally facing platforms. Within this team, the Corporate Communications Developer is the expert in associate communications by crafting strategies and delivering impactful messages that resonate across Publix. From personalized communications to large-scale campaigns, this role is essential in driving engagement and reinforcing Publix's culture. The Developer uses creativity and strategic insight to promote our company's vision, facilitate change and inspire associates to become brand advocates. The position reports to the Manager of Corporate Communications. 
What you'll do 

  • develop strategic communication plans that support business initiatives  
  • develop communications directed to internal and external audiences, including communications that educate and inform associates of company strategy, initiatives and goals 
  • help other departments provide accurate and timely information  
  • serve as the subject matter expert in associate-directed communications and counsel internal clients on communication strategies in order to meet company and project or department objectives 
  • develop scripts and speeches for company leaders
